Backup exec followed symlink - backed up data twice

Carlos_Rosa
Level 3
hello,

Backing up a redhat 8.0 with unix agent installed.

I have the following NFS export

/export

It's added to the exclude list in the agent.cfg file

i had a user create a symlink in the home directory as such

/home/user/export -> /export

This caused /export to get backed up twice. I also added /n in the exlude list in the job set up too.

Is there something I'm missing?

One of the options on the job description should be

"Backup Data by following Links?"

If this is selected, deselect it.

Carlos_Rosa
Level 3
Ken,
I believe you meant "Back up contents of soft-linked directories"

This was unchecked when I ran test jobs which still backed up twice.

"Back up files and directories by following junction points" is checked. I ran it with this option on/off with the same results.

Otherwise, the problem is gone after removing the symlink from the problem directory.
